Android中自定义属性与格式标签详解。
在Android项目的实际开发中,免不了要自定义一些控件或者view,更高深一点的自定义view也应该可以直接在xml自定义属性,今天就来分享下自定义属性的格式。
1. reference:参考某一资源ID
属性定义:
<declar[......]
一.@代表引用资源
1.引用自定义资源。格式:@[package:]type/name
android:text=”@string/hello”
2.引用系统资源。格式:@android:type/name
a[......]
Linux内核移植知识教程。1.1 Linux内核基础知识 在动手进行Linux内核移植之前,非常有必要对Linux内核进行一定的了解,下面从Linux内核的版本和分类说起。 1.1.1 Linux版本 Linux内核的版本号可以从源代码的顶层目录下的Makefile中看到,比如2.6.29.1内核[......]
Linux内核-进程调度管理。
1.多任务
#抢占式多任务:由调度程序来决定什么时间停止一个进程的运行
#进程的时间片:分配给每个可运行进程的处理器时间段
2.Linux的进程调度
#O(1)调度程序
#反转楼梯最后期限调度算法(RSDL)
#完全公平调度算法(CFS)[......]
Android布局属性大全|实例代码。
第一类:属性值为true或false
android:layout_centerHrizontal 水平居中
android:layout_centerVertical 垂直居中
android:layout_centerInparent 相对于父[......]
android XML属性介绍。在学习控件的过程中我们应该对一些常用的XML属性有更深入的理解,这有利于我们继续学习Android的高级技术。
1:android:id
如果要在代码或在XML布局文件中引用某个控件,该控件必须要设置android:id的属性-@id/value或者@+id/[......]
struts2 标签 struts2 自定义标签 实例
(1)
其实,开发自定义标签并不需要Struts2的支持,一般情况下,只需要继承
javax.servlet.jsp.tagext.BodyTagSupport类,重写doStartTag,doEndTag等方法即可。
在s[......]
C#程序从32位系统迁移到64位系统的问题。
前段用C#做了个程序,现在要把程序支持64位系统。
首先是把该程序支持到 Windows Server 2003 和 Windows Server 2008两个系统,由于我的程序是在XP上测试编译的,直接拿过去不会出什么问题吧,
但是在运行[......]
UNREFERENCED_PARAMETER。
UNREFERENCED_PARAMETER是一个宏,定义如下
#define UNREFERENCED_PARAMETER(P) (P)
MSDN上的说明如下:
UNREFERENCED_PARAMETER expands to the[......]
驱动开发中使用安全字符串函数。
一、前言
大量的系统安全问题是由于薄弱的缓冲处理以及由此产生的缓冲区溢出造成的,而薄弱的缓冲区处理常常与字符串操作相关。c/c++语言运行库提供的标准字符串操作函数(strcpy, strcat, sprintf等)不能阻止在超出字符串尾端的写入。
基于Wi[......]